The Yaskawa 132015-3 cable serves as a signal manipulator suitable for robotic applications. Its design emphasizes durability and flexibility, with a static bending radius of five times the outer diameter and a dynamic bending radius of ten times. The enclosure holds an IP66 rating, confirming its ability to withstand water and dust.
This cable has a voltage rating of 600 V and can handle currents up to 15 A. It features connectors that are straight male and straight female. With a minimum insulation resistance of 5 MΩ·km, the 132015-3 cable ensures effective electrical isolation. It utilizes an M32x1.5 cable gland for secure attachment within systems.
Measuring 5 meters in length and with an outer diameter of 15 mm, this manipulator cable is designed for continuous flexing, making it ideal for dynamic applications. The conductor consists of tinned copper, which is efficient for signal transmission. Its jacket is made of polyurethane (PUR), providing excellent protection against wear and environmental stress.
Operating within a temperature range of 0°C to 50°C, the cable remains functional across various industrial settings. Additionally, it incorporates a tinned copper braided shield to enhance signal integrity and minimize electromagnetic interference.
